WebTreatment. Superficial venous thrombosis is inflammation and clotting in a superficial vein, usually in the arms or legs. The skin over the vein becomes red, swollen, and painful. Doctors examine the area, but tests are not usually needed. People may need to take analgesics to relieve pain until the disorder resolves. WebJan 1, 2011 · Challenge #2: Veins are hard to access. Ernst's solution: Oncology patients' fragile veins are prone to collapse, so be sure to select the right equipment for the puncture. Use syringes and 23-gauge needles or 23-gauge butterfly needles with syringes attached to control the negative pressure applied to the vein's interior. WebDoes dehydration make it hard to draw blood? Drinking water before you get your blood drawn is equally important, too. If you walk into a blood bank without drinking lots of water before, everyone involved will have a harder time. The more water you drink, the plumper your veins are. This makes it easier for the phlebotomist to find your vein.
